About two months ago I attended a workshop that gave me an opportunity to clear some cobwebs allowing me to draw closer to God. Working through the mazes of the mind and bypassing the criticisms of the ego and my fears I was able to “meet” God at the point of creation. One of the beautiful gifts I received was one of understanding how the flow of energy works instead of working against the grain I now know that by moving around a word or two the gift flows freely and with grace. Many of us have heard the phrase that you must give in order to receive. What I was given was the understanding that “As you receive, so shall you give.”

Consider how this statement makes you feel and what you may contemplate and consider. For me, I thought that in order for me to get something I better give something. Makes sense to my ego, but somehow I just really didn’t achieve a level of fulfillment that I now do with approaching life with this new mantra.
